生成需求跟踪矩阵是什么

生成需求跟踪矩阵是什么

生成需求跟踪矩阵的核心步骤是确定需求、映射需求与设计、标识需求变更、评估需求满足情况、维护矩阵更新。需求跟踪矩阵(RTM)是项目管理中的一个重要工具,用于确保所有需求都被准确跟踪和实现。它通过将需求与其对应的设计、开发和测试活动进行映射,帮助项目团队确保每个需求都能被满足,从而提高项目成功的可能性。下面将详细阐述如何生成需求跟踪矩阵,并讨论其中的关键步骤。

一、确定需求

在生成需求跟踪矩阵之前,首先需要确定项目的所有需求。这包括功能需求、非功能需求、业务需求等。需求可以通过多种方式获取,如客户访谈、问卷调查、市场调研等。所有需求应当被详细记录并编号,以便后续的跟踪和管理。

需求收集是项目启动阶段的关键步骤。项目团队应与相关利益相关方进行深入沟通,确保所有需求都被清晰、准确地记录下来。这不仅包括客户或用户的需求,还应包括项目团队内部的技术需求和业务需求。需求收集的结果应形成一份需求文档(例如需求规格说明书),作为生成需求跟踪矩阵的基础。

二、映射需求与设计

在需求确定之后,接下来是将这些需求映射到具体的设计和实现上。这包括将需求与系统设计、模块设计、具体功能实现等进行关联。通过这种映射,可以确保每个需求都有对应的设计和实现方案,从而提高需求的可追溯性和实现的准确性。

将需求映射到设计上需要项目团队的协作。系统架构师、开发人员、测试人员等应共同参与,确保每个需求都能被准确地实现。映射过程应详细记录,以便在生成需求跟踪矩阵时能够清晰地展示需求与设计的对应关系。

三、标识需求变更

在项目执行过程中,需求变更是不可避免的。为了确保需求跟踪矩阵的准确性和有效性,项目团队需要及时标识和记录所有需求变更。这包括记录变更的原因、变更的具体内容、变更对项目的影响等。

标识需求变更需要建立一套有效的变更管理流程。项目团队应设立专门的变更控制委员会,负责审核和批准需求变更。所有变更应通过正式的变更请求流程进行记录和跟踪,确保所有相关方都能及时了解和响应变更。

四、评估需求满足情况

需求跟踪矩阵不仅要记录需求与设计的对应关系,还应评估每个需求的满足情况。这包括对需求的实现情况进行跟踪和评估,确保所有需求都能够被满足。项目团队可以通过定期的需求审查、测试和验证等方式,评估需求的满足情况。

评估需求满足情况需要项目团队的持续关注。项目经理应定期组织需求审查会议,邀请相关利益相关方参与,评估需求的实现情况。测试团队应制定详细的测试计划,确保所有需求都能够被充分测试和验证。评估结果应记录在需求跟踪矩阵中,作为项目管理的重要依据。

五、维护矩阵更新

需求跟踪矩阵是一个动态的工具,需要项目团队持续维护和更新。随着项目的进展,需求、设计、实现等信息会不断变化,需求跟踪矩阵也需要及时更新,确保其准确性和有效性。

维护矩阵更新需要项目团队的协作和沟通。项目经理应定期检查需求跟踪矩阵的更新情况,确保所有信息都能够及时、准确地记录。项目团队应建立一套有效的沟通机制,确保所有相关方都能够及时了解和响应需求的变化。

具体生成需求跟踪矩阵的步骤

  1. 收集并记录需求:从项目启动阶段开始,项目团队应收集并记录所有需求,包括功能需求、非功能需求、业务需求等。

  2. 编号需求:为了便于跟踪和管理,每个需求应当被详细记录并编号。

  3. 映射需求与设计:将需求与系统设计、模块设计、具体功能实现等进行关联,确保每个需求都有对应的设计和实现方案。

  4. 标识需求变更:在项目执行过程中,及时标识和记录所有需求变更,并通过正式的变更请求流程进行记录和跟踪。

  5. 评估需求满足情况:通过定期的需求审查、测试和验证等方式,评估每个需求的实现情况。

  6. 维护矩阵更新:随着项目的进展,需求、设计、实现等信息会不断变化,需求跟踪矩阵需要及时更新,确保其准确性和有效性。

工具推荐

在生成需求跟踪矩阵时,项目团队可以使用一些专业的需求管理工具来提高工作效率。例如,PingCodeWorktile都是非常优秀的需求管理工具,可以帮助项目团队更好地记录、跟踪和管理需求。

PingCode 是国内市场占有率非常高的一款需求管理工具,具有强大的需求管理功能,可以帮助项目团队轻松生成需求跟踪矩阵,并实现需求的全生命周期管理。

Worktile 是一款通用型的项目管理系统,支持需求管理、任务管理、进度管理等多种项目管理功能,可以帮助项目团队更好地组织和管理项目,提高项目的成功率。

PingCode官网】、【Worktile官网

总结

生成需求跟踪矩阵是项目管理中的一个重要步骤,可以帮助项目团队确保所有需求都被准确跟踪和实现。通过确定需求、映射需求与设计、标识需求变更、评估需求满足情况、维护矩阵更新等步骤,项目团队可以生成一份详细、准确的需求跟踪矩阵,从而提高项目的成功率。在生成需求跟踪矩阵时,项目团队可以使用一些专业的需求管理工具,如PingCode和Worktile,来提高工作效率。

相关问答FAQs:

FAQ 1: 什么是需求跟踪矩阵?

需求跟踪矩阵是一种工具或技术,用于追踪和管理项目或产品的需求。它通常以矩阵形式展示,其中需求被列在一侧,而各个阶段或功能被列在另一侧。通过需求跟踪矩阵,项目团队可以清楚地了解每个需求与特定功能、设计、测试等阶段之间的关系,从而确保需求的完整性和一致性。

FAQ 2: 需求跟踪矩阵有什么作用?

需求跟踪矩阵可以帮助项目团队在整个项目或产品开发过程中跟踪和管理需求。它可以帮助团队成员了解每个需求的状态、进展和相关责任人,从而提高需求的可追溯性和透明度。此外,需求跟踪矩阵还可以帮助团队识别和解决需求之间的依赖关系和冲突,确保项目按时交付,并满足客户的期望。

FAQ 3: 如何创建一个需求跟踪矩阵?

创建需求跟踪矩阵需要以下步骤:

  1. 首先,明确项目或产品的需求列表,将其列出并编号。
  2. 其次,确定项目或产品的各个阶段或功能,并将其列出并编号。
  3. 然后,将需求列表与阶段或功能列表相交叉,形成一个矩阵。
  4. 接下来,填写矩阵中的单元格,指示每个需求在每个阶段或功能中的状态、进展和责任人。
  5. 最后,定期更新需求跟踪矩阵,确保它与项目或产品的实际进展保持一致。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/5163768

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部